Winter Wonderland

Winter Wonderland Oh let the lovely winter soon arrive With its sparkling blanket of pristine white. How winter season makes me feel alive With scarlet colored cardinals in flight. Glory of this season enchants my sight As twilight sees stars twinkle with moonlight. Children laugh, building snowmen during day, Snow ladies too with eyes of coal that glow, Hoping that freezing snow has come to stay So kids can form snowballs to toss in snow At unsuspecting adults they will throw, As snowpeople stand-by to view the show! I love to watch the little ones have fun Sitting on a bench amidst snow flocked trees Feeling the warming comfort of the sun. Children love making snow angels that please. They play all day 'til some begin to sneeze When prompted from a stronger colder breeze. A snowscape of small angels from God's hand, This is my view of winter wonderland! 12-15-18 A STRAND (1051) Poetry Contest N/A Sponsor Brian Strand 1-13-22 Winter Wonderland Contest Sponsor Emile Pinet Urban Sonnet Invented by: Laura Loo. Sonnet form, with 10 syllables per line and a rhyme scheme of: ABABBB- CDCDDD- EFEFFF-GG
